What happened
Tempus AI (TEM) stock jumped 10.67% to $68.85 on Tuesday, driven by its 100,000-genome research platform launch and investors' rotation away from chip stocks, down 5.9% on AI safety concerns. On September 11 the company unveiled plans to build the world's largest disease-specific whole-genome dataset — 100,000 genomes linked to clinical outcomes, eventually targeting one million — accessible through its Tempus Lens research platform. The same day, H.C. Wainwright raised its price target from $56 to $66, citing Tempus's first quarterly net profit of $5.6 million on Q2 revenue of $382.5 million, up 22% from a year earlier. The broader selloff was triggered by AI executives from Anthropic, OpenAI, and xAI publicly backing a slowdown in development, while the 10-year Treasury yield briefly touched 5%, pushing investors toward healthcare names seen as insulated from both pressures.
Why it matters
Tempus AI sits at the crossroads of two trends investors are now treating very differently: AI-driven research tools, which get punished when rate fears or AI-slowdown worries rise, and healthcare diagnostics data, which earns steady fees from hospitals and drug companies regardless of the economic cycle. For most of 2026 the stock sold off alongside pure-play AI names, so Tuesday's sharp outperformance against a 5.9% chip-index drop is the clearest sign yet that the market may be starting to price precision-medicine AI separately from semiconductor-dependent infrastructure bets.
